Enrichment of a fullerene mixture with endohedral metallofullerenes: methodology and evaluation

, , , , , & ORCID Icon show all
Received 14 Feb 2024, Accepted 28 Mar 2024, Published online: 22 Apr 2024
 

Abstract

A fullerene mixture was enriched with endohedral metallofullerenes (EMF) using Lewis acid (TiCl4), which took 22 min, whereas the standard method requires about 8 h. An algorithm for assessing small-area chromatographic peaks has been proposed, which has improved the accuracy of determination. For example, the area of the C84 peak was 4.24% using the developed program, while the use of chromatograph software estimated the area of this peak to be 1.78%.
